Versatile File Formats

DCI Billboard Displays allow for multiple file formats to be shown on the display. Video formats include AVI, SWF, MPG, and GIF files. Picture formats include BMP, JPEG, WMF, and EMF files.

The majority of third party software will be able to export to at least one of these file types.
